Product Management Tradeoff Question: Digital banking platform balancing personalization and privacy concerns

Introduction

Balancing personalization features against data privacy concerns for NCR's digital banking platform presents a critical trade-off. This scenario involves weighing the benefits of enhanced user experience through personalization against the potential risks and user concerns related to data privacy. I'll analyze this trade-off by examining the product context, identifying key metrics, designing experiments, and providing a strategic recommendation.

Analysis Approach

I'd like to outline my approach to ensure we're aligned on the key areas I'll be covering in my analysis.

Step 1

Clarifying Questions (3 minutes)

  • Based on the current market trends, I'm thinking personalization might be a key differentiator for digital banking platforms. Could you share more about our competitive landscape and how personalization fits into our overall strategy?

Why it matters: Helps prioritize personalization efforts against market demands Expected answer: Personalization is a top priority to compete with fintech disruptors Impact on approach: Would justify more aggressive personalization features if true

  • Considering user behavior, I'm assuming our platform serves a diverse user base with varying privacy preferences. Can you provide insights into our user segments and their attitudes towards data sharing?

Why it matters: Informs the balance between personalization and privacy for different user groups Expected answer: Mix of tech-savvy users open to data sharing and privacy-conscious traditionalists Impact on approach: Would suggest a tiered approach to personalization with opt-in features

  • From a technical standpoint, I'm thinking about the complexity of implementing granular privacy controls. What's our current data architecture like, and how flexible is it for implementing variable levels of personalization?

Why it matters: Determines the feasibility and timeline for implementing sophisticated personalization features Expected answer: Modular architecture with some legacy systems Impact on approach: Might require a phased rollout of personalization features

  • Regarding resources, I'm curious about our team's capacity for this initiative. Do we have dedicated privacy and personalization experts, or would this require new hires or training?

Why it matters: Affects the scope and timeline of implementing new features Expected answer: Limited in-house expertise, may require external consultants Impact on approach: Could influence the decision to prioritize either personalization or privacy initially

  • Considering timelines, I'm wondering if there are any regulatory deadlines or market pressures driving this decision. Are there any upcoming compliance requirements or competitor launches we need to consider?

Why it matters: Helps prioritize features and set realistic implementation timelines Expected answer: New data privacy regulations coming into effect in 6 months Impact on approach: Would prioritize privacy features to ensure compliance before expanding personalization
